Question 360622: Wang starts a project, which he can finish in 20 days. Five days later after he starts, his company sends Lee to help. Together, they finishes the project in 5 more days. If Wang is paid $ 100 a day, what is a fair daily salary for Lee?

Wang can do the job in 20 days or 1/20 of the job each day
after 5 days Wang has done 5/20 or 1/4 of the job
--
Lee can do the job in L days or 1/L of the job each day
working together Wang and Lee get 1/20+1/L of the job done each day
--
There is only 3/4 of the job left when Lee joins in and it takes 5 days
--
5(1/20+1/L)=3/4 solve for L
1/4+5/L=3/4
5/L=3/4-1/4=1/2
cross multiply
L=10, so it takes Lee 10 days to do the job by himself which is twice as fast as Wang of 20 days to get the job done
==
So if Wang gets $100/day then Lee should get $200/day
